The Licensed Insurance Representative Assistant provides administrative support to the Contact Centre Staff.

How you will create impact
  • Responsible for preparing letters, endorsements, liability slips, binders, 3rd party requests and experience letters to our clients by means of LIR request via the Datacapture database and the LIRA queue.
  • Responsible for the administrative Exdate process working with sales and marketing.
  • Process the pool of risk alert abeyances.
  • Responsible for monitoring Internet services and sales email boxes and taking appropriate action.
